Guidelines for Flat Surface Installation
Locate the switch within 152 cm (5 ft) of its power source and on a surface as shown in
Figure
3‐2. If an optional redundant power system is going to be installed and connected
to the 14‐pin Redundant Power Supply input connector on the rear of the switch, refer to
the installation guide shipped with the redundant power system.
Caution: To ensure proper ventilation and prevent overheating, leave a minimum
clearance space of 5.1 cm (2.0 in.) at the left, right, and rear of the switch.
Do not connect the switch to the AC power source until instructed to do so later in the
installation process.
